Seniors-for-Seniors Adoption Program

senior for seniors program

Research shows that having a pet in the home has many positive health and emotional benefits, and adopting an older pet saves the life of a homeless shelter animal.

The Seniors-for-Seniors Adoption Program at Lollypop Farm eliminates adoption fees for seniors adopting older pets. Adoption fees are waived for senior citizens sixty (60) years and older who are adopting qualified pets that are six (6) years and older. This includes everything that normally comes with an adoption: spay/neuter surgery, vaccinations, deworming, microchipping, flea treatment, 30 gift of pet health insurance, free exam with a veterinarian and and ID tag.

Senior citizens adopting dogs and cats between the ages of one and six receive a discount of $50.

For more information, speak with an Adoption Counselor when visiting the shelter.



Pets for Patriots

Lollypop Farm is a proud partner in the Pets for Patriots Program. This program is available to veterans, wounded warriors, and service members of all armed forces. To join, and individual must apply through Pets for Patriots at www.petsforpatriots.org or 1-877-473-8223. Once an individual is approved, they receive a membership ID and may adopt a qualifying animal at Lollypop Farm for half the cost of the adoption fee. Benefits of membership also include 10% off pet care costs at participating providers, and reduced costs for pet food and supplies.

Pets for Patriots logo

A qualifying animal must meet ONE of the following 3 criteria:

  • An adult dog or cat, two years of age or older
  • Large dogs, 40 pounds or more
  • Special-needs dog or cat, which may be disabled or otherwise limited in its physical abilities to injury, birth defect, prior abuse or neglect.


Barn Cat Program

Barn Cat Poster

Some cats admitted to Lollypop Farm may not be feral but may exhibit behaviors that would not make them a candidate for a home environment. These cats may be considered for our Barn Cat Program. This is a mutual companionship program where an individual with a barn can provide a loving home to a cat and fulfill all the responsibilities of a pet owner, while receiving the benefit of an animal to monitor the rodent population often found in barns.

If you are interested in adopting a cat for your barn, please download the Barn Cat Home Request Form and contact Amanda Smith-Hatch at (585) 223-1330, x104. The adoption fee for these cats is $25.



Meet Your Match® Feline-ality™ Adoption Program

Lollypop Farm is pleased to offer the Meet Your Match® Feline-ality™ Adoption Program, a program of the ASPCA®. This research-based program was created by Emily Weiss, Ph.D., in conjunction with the American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(ASPCA®).

Meet Your Match logo

The Meet Your Match® Adoption Program is comprised of two parts:

  1. The first part, the cat assessment, helps us determine the individual needs of each cat. We test each cat aged nine months or older to help us determine the general feline-ality including friendliness, playfulness, reception to petting and holding, valiance and independence. Each cat is then categorized into a personality color according to their scores. These categories are color-coded green, orange and purple.
    Meet the Feline-ality types »
  2. The second part is an Adopter Survey which helps us determine your color and we can begin to match an animal's behaviors to your expectations, experience, lifestyle, and home environment. You'll receive a color-coded Guest Pass to help guide you to an animal that may best meet your expectations and lifestyle. For example, if your pass is orange, look for an animal with an orange kennel card (but you aren't tied to that color if you see another cat that pulls at your heart strings!).
At Lollypop Farm, cats aged nine months and older are included in the Feline-ality program. Whether you are looking for an adult cat or a kitten, the Adopter Survey will help you understand the kind of cat that fits best in your home!
